Common Residential Hardwood Service Jobs
Hardwood floor refinishing - restores the original beauty and smoothness of worn or scratched hardwood surfaces.
Hardwood floor installation - adds durable and attractive flooring options to new or renovated spaces.
Hardwood floor repair - fixes cracks, gouges, or water damage to maintain the integrity of existing hardwood.
Hardwood floor sanding - prepares floors for finishing by removing surface imperfections and old finishes.
Hardwood floor staining - enhances wood tones and adds color to match interior design preferences.
Hardwood floor cleaning - keeps floors looking their best through professional cleaning and maintenance.
Residential Hardwood Service Questions
What types of hardwood flooring are available for residential projects? Common options include oak, maple, cherry, and hickory, each offering different styles and durability levels suitable for homes in Phoenix.
How can hardwood floors be maintained to look their best? Regular sweeping and occasional damp mopping help preserve the appearance and prevent damage from dust and debris.
What are common residential hardwood flooring services? Services often include installation, refinishing, repair, and sanding to restore or update existing hardwood floors.
Is hardwood flooring suitable for all areas of a home? Hardwood can be used in most living spaces, but areas prone to moisture, like bathrooms, may require additional considerations or alternative flooring options.
